Abstract: (Elsevier)
The recent general solution by Atiyah, Hitchin, Drinfeld and Manin of the self-duality equations for an arbitrary compact classical group is discussed. The Green function for a scalar field transforming as a vector under the group is shown to take an elegant form in the background field of the general self-dual solution.
